Embodiment 1

[0034] A magnesium-rich leaf nutrient, comprising the following components in parts by weight: 70 parts of water-soluble magnesium fertilizer, 8 parts of chelated magnesium, Fulvic acid 3 parts, 2 parts of nucleotides, 1 part of rare earth, 8 parts of plant growth promoter, 6 parts of auxiliary trace elements, 3.5 parts of surfactant.

Embodiment 2

[0036] A magnesium-rich leaf nutrient, comprising the following components in parts by weight: 75 parts of water-soluble magnesium fertilizer, 5 parts of chelated magnesium, 2 parts of fulvic acid, 3 parts of nucleotides, 0.6 part of rare earth, plant growth promoting 5 parts of agent, 5 parts of auxiliary material trace elements, 4.4 parts of surfactant.

Embodiment 3

[0038] A magnesium-rich leaf nutrient, comprising the following components in parts by weight: 65 parts of water-soluble magnesium fertilizer, 10 parts of chelated magnesium, Fulvic acid 3 parts, 2 parts of nucleotides, 8 parts of plant growth promoters, 8 parts of auxiliary trace elements, and 4 parts of surfactants.

[0039] The preparation method of the magnesium-rich foliage nutrient of embodiment 1-3:

[0040] 1. Weigh water-soluble magnesium fertilizer, chelated magnesium, fulvic acid, nucleotides, rare earths, plant growth promoters, auxiliary trace elements, and surfactants according to specific gravity;

[0041] 2. Mix water-soluble magnesium fertilizer, chelated magnesium, rare earth, plant growth promoter, auxiliary trace elements, and surfactant evenly;

[0042] 3. Pack into bags and vacuumize the bags after packing; fulvic acid and nucleotides are packed separately.

Abstract

The invention relates to the field of microelement fertilizer research and particularly discloses a magnesium-rich foliar nutrient and application thereof in tea planting. The magnesium-rich foliar nutrient is prepared from the following raw materials in parts by weight: 65-72 parts of a water-soluble magnesium fertilizer, 5-10 parts of chelating magnesium, 2-4 parts of fulvic acid, 1-3 parts of nucleotide, 0-1 part of rare earth, 5-12 parts of a plant growth accelerator, 5-10 parts of accessory microelements, 3-5 parts of a surfactant, an instant magnesium fertilizer and a surfactant. The timeliness and the absorptivity are considered, and the magnesium-rich foliar nutrient is mainly applied to the aspect of tea tree planting. The magnesium-rich foliar nutrient has the beneficial effects that the problem of magnesium deficiency in planting process of commercial crops, such as tea trees is mainly solved; the magnesium-rich foliar nutrient is especially suitable for sandy soil and acid soil; absorption of the foliar nutrient is promoted by adopting the surfactant and the nutritional ingredients are high in permeability and absorptivity; the magnesium-rich foliar nutrient contains a production regulator, so that plant cell division is promoted, the yield of plants is improved and the cooperation effect of a growth regulator and a magnesium fertilizer is better; and the formula is reasonable, the yield-increasing effect is obvious and the content of effective ingredients in the tea is improved.

Description

technical field [0001] The invention relates to the field of trace fertilizer research, in particular to a magnesium-rich foliar nutrient and its application in tea plantation. Background technique [0002] Trace element fertilizers are usually referred to as micro-fertilizers for short. Refers to fertilizers containing micronutrient elements, which are less absorbed and consumed by crops (compared to macronutrient fertilizers). Although crops require very little trace elements, they are equally important to crops like macro elements and cannot replace each other. The application of micro-fertilizers must be based on nitrogen, phosphorus, and potassium fertilizers to exert their fertilizer effects. [0003] Magnesium is one of the main components of chlorophyll in plants and is related to photosynthesis of plants.
